2. Ideal Climate Conditions for Maximum Solar Output

Saudi Arabia’s geographic location provides exceptionally high solar radiation, making solar panels extremely productive throughout the year. Desert regions, industrial zones, and urban rooftops offer vast areas for solar deployment.

This natural advantage means solar systems deliver higher electricity yields, making investments more profitable and reliable over the long term.

3. Solar Power as a Solution to Growing Electricity Demand

Urbanization, population growth, and industrial expansion are driving electricity consumption to new heights. Traditional energy generation alone cannot efficiently meet these rising demands.

Solar energy enables decentralized power production, allowing businesses, communities, and households to generate their own electricity — easing grid pressure and improving energy stability.

6. Energy Independence and Grid Reliability

Solar power reduces reliance on centralized power generation and imported energy resources. Distributed solar systems improve energy security by diversifying supply sources and strengthening grid resilience during peak demand.

In remote regions, solar systems also provide reliable electricity where traditional infrastructure is difficult or costly to deploy.

9. Advancing Technology and Smart Energy Systems

Innovations in battery storage, energy management software, and high-efficiency solar panels are accelerating adoption. These technologies allow users to store excess energy, optimize consumption, and maintain power continuity during grid outages.

Such advancements ensure solar energy remains reliable, intelligent, and future-ready.
